Key Features: That 3000-lumen number is real output, not marketing exaggeration. To put it in perspective, a standard household bulb is maybe 800 lumens. This is nearly four times that—concentrated into a beam you can point. When you hit someone’s dark-adapted eyes with this, they’re experiencing what’s called flash blindness. It’s temporary, but it’s complete. They’re not seeing anything for several seconds, and their vision stays compromised for up to a minute. That’s your window to escape or respond.

The zoom function is simple but effective. The head extends to narrow the beam, creating a focused spotlight that reaches over 1,300 feet—that’s a quarter mile of light projection. Retract it and you get a wide flood beam for area illumination. Both modes have their uses: the spotlight for identifying threats at distance, the flood for navigating unfamiliar terrain or lighting up your entire surroundings. Most situations call for flood; specific threats call for spotlight.

The strobe mode rapidly pulses the light, which is disorienting even if someone isn’t looking directly at it. It messes with depth perception and makes it difficult to track movement or focus on a target. The SOS mode flashes the international distress signal—useful if you’re broken down, lost, or need to signal rescuers. How long does the battery last on a full charge?

Runtime depends on which mode you’re using. On full 3000-lumen blast, you’re looking at maybe 2-3 hours of continuous use. Drop to a lower setting (most tactical lights have multiple brightness levels), and you’ll get significantly longer runtime. For defensive purposes, this is more than enough—actual confrontations last seconds to minutes, not hours. For extended use like camping or power outages, cycle through brightness levels to conserve battery. Charge it monthly even if you’re not using it; lithium batteries don’t like sitting dead.

Will this permanently damage someone’s eyes?

No. The temporary flash blindness caused by bright light is just that—temporary. Their vision will recover fully, typically within 30-60 seconds, though some effect can last a few minutes. There’s no permanent retinal damage from brief exposure to even very bright LED light. This is well-documented in military and law enforcement contexts where tactical lights are standard equipment. The point is creating a window of opportunity, not causing injury.
